Step 4: Wire up FareForge. The shipping-fee rules engine at Brindlemart won't boot without its signing secret, and yes, it fails silently — you'll just get free shipping for everyone, which finance will notice before you do. Pull the current secret from the Quartzvault locker (ask anyone on the Ledgerline team if you're locked out), then open config/fareforge.env on the deploy box. Don't commit this file, ever. Add the following line to the bottom of that file exactly as shown.

sealed setting: ARCHIVE_KEY3=8d0

Hey folks — handing off LiftPath release duties to Mara while I'm out. The elevator-dispatch simulator ships Thursdays; build 4.2 is staged and the scenario packs are frozen. Only gotcha: the dispatch-core artifact won't promote unless it's signed before the smoke suite kicks off, so do that first, not after. Everything else is in the runbook on the Ostermill wiki. Mara, you'll need the deploy key to push to the release channel, so pasting it here for the sync notes.

deploy key for tawip-bawig: bky13_1zSxDtVxnNkjh

## Build Provenance: GrainPay Export v7

Heads up, plugin folks — the payroll export moved from fixed-width to delimited fields in v7, so anything parsing by column offset will break. Every export file now carries provenance metadata so you can trace exactly which build produced it. For reference, the token for the first v7 production build is below.

build token for kagaf-hahof: htk14_9d3d4d26d7d8de

Subject: ScanBridge cut-over done

Cut-over to ScanBridge v4 finished at 02:10. All Velk warehouse scanners now route through the new decoder. Old endpoint stays up read-only until Friday, then Priya kills it. Two misreads during the window, both retried clean. Pager rotation unchanged. If the decoder hiccups, restart the pod before escalating. Current production configuration follows below.

settings of kajog-bajof:
[fraion]
host = fraion.orvexworks.internal
user = fraion_svc
database = fraion_prod